How to Correct Shaky Video with the Stabilization Effect in Final Cut Pro X

Фильм және анимация

Final Cut Pro X includes some great built-in stabilization tools, which can reduce camera motion so that they play back more smoothly. You can smooth a clip's shaky footage by correcting the stabilization, rolling shutter, or both. We'll take a look at each of these stabilization tools and go over exactly how they work.

    Hello! Thanks for the video. So, I watched this and stabilized a one take video. I just ended the color grading process and when I was about to export, I cropped (sliced, bladed, make shorter) the last part of the video. When I did that it appeared "Analyzing for dominant motion" and it automatically zooms out the whole image (I am almost sure it has something to do with stabilization). But I wanted this to be exactly as it was without the zooming out. Is there a way to do this without Final Cut Pro automatically modifying the image. I don't know if manually zooming in or exporting (which format?) and then cropping that exported video will work, but I am afraid it will loose quality. Thank you! (Hope i made myself clear.

  • @pixelfilmstudios

    @pixelfilmstudios

    Жыл бұрын

    You might have to compound the clip before you crop it to make sure the changes to the clip are not affected. To compound a clip press Option + G or right click on the clip and press "New Compound Clip." Exporting the clip as a full video, then importing it back in to the project as a video to crop would also be a viable option.
